Output 73fc8a2e83bb297fc603cd8cd1f900a7ecfd142251026291cbfc5cf4ed2101a6:0

value
18736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fcae77ae0f82a56bd80f48701fe52875c3f152d OP_EQUALVERIFY OP_CHECKSIG
address
18GuTBqehNa2pxsJjsR8bdozy5ZnnfGRWv
transaction
73fc8a2e83bb297fc603cd8cd1f900a7ecfd142251026291cbfc5cf4ed2101a6
confirmations
289462
spent
true